Panchang for New Delhi on Wednesday, 2 December 2026 — the vedic almanac shows you the day's tithi (lunar day), nakshatra (lunar mansion), yoga, karana and vara, alongside accurate sunrise and sunset times. The Rahu Kaal, Yamaganda and Gulika windows highlight inauspicious periods to avoid for new ventures, while Abhijit and Brahma muhurtas mark the most powerful auspicious slots of the day.
